STOCK DIVIDEND AND STOCK SPLIT

The most common method for companies to distribute wealth among shareholders is to pay dividends in the form of cash or stock. When a company has a low level of liquid cash on hand, stock dividends are typically issued in lieu of cash dividends. It is the board of directors that decides whether a dividend should be declared and in what form it should be distributed. Dividend yield is also a financial ratio that shows how much a company pays out in dividends on its shares each year, which is something investors look for in a stock.

When was the last time ES stock split?
ES stock split took place on 30-04-2013.
How did ES's stock split work?
Its last split took place on Apr 30, 2013, when Eversource Energy went through a 2:1 split leaving the shareholder with 2 share(s) who previously owned 1 ES share(s).
